Thought I would share what little knowledge I have on the Xantrex GTI 
and this issue...  

My undestanding is that this occurs when the GTI software is used 
without a GTI connected.  Internally the GTI includes a pass-thru relay 
which connects the AC loads directly to the grid when AC power is 
available.  If the GTI is not used or is connected incorrectly (or is 
not operating) than the loads are still being powered from the inverter 
which is pulsing its output as you describe as part of its islanding 
protection scheme.  

So does the customer have a GTI box on the system?

> > > >I have a customer who had his pre-GTI Trace SW
> > > >inverters retrofitted with the new anti-islanding
> > > >software.  He claims that ever since the upgrade
> > > his
> > > >flourescent lights powered by the backed up loads
> > > >panel have a flicker that pulses about once every
> > > >second.  Sometimes the flicker is worse than other
> > > >times.
> > > >
> > > >Since the anti-islanding software is supposed to
> > > >disconnect and reconnect to the grid once per
> > > second,
> > > >I can't help but wonder if my customer isn't
> > > justified
> > > >by blaming the software upgrade.
> > > >
> > > >Has anyone had or heard of similar experiences?
> > > And
> > > >better yet, does anyone have ideas to solve this
> > > >problem?  I want to keep this customer relationship
> > > in
> > > >good standing.
